- [ ] Before the Quillhaven signing ceremony proceeds, run the leaked-file-descriptor hunt on the offline signer. As a new contractor, please be thorough: enumerate every open descriptor on the sealed host, confirm nothing points at the ceremony scratch volume, and log each finding in the Larkspur register. If any descriptor traces back to the retired Fenwick exporter, halt and page the ceremony lead. Once the host shows a clean descriptor table, unlock the escrow envelope using the phrase below.

unlock words, yajof-tagef: aldiel-kasath-briax-fraeth-pelius-olieth-pelix-wenius-wenael-norael

Ticket: Harrowline telemetry gateway drops soil-sensor frames

New folks: the Harrowline gateway buffers frames from combine and irrigation units, but under poor cell coverage it silently discards soil-sensor packets older than ninety seconds. Expected behavior is store-and-forward. Reproduce with the simulator's low-signal profile, then attach the gateway's trace token, reproduced below.

session token of kageg-tahop = htk14_af3c1ccccb7dcf

## Markdown Rendering Pipeline

Welcome to the Pellworth docs team. Our markdown pipeline converts source files through the Inkmere renderer, which sanitizes HTML, resolves includes, and emits versioned output. Local previews hit the staging renderer directly. To run previews, your client must authenticate to Inkmere with the internal key below.

service key, yadug-bajog: zpat3_pou